Wrapped AyeAyeCoin Classic

ayeAyeCoin is the first named token contract ever deployed in Ethereum. As it was named after a long fingered semi extinct lemur, native from Madasgar, itยดs also considered as the first animal and meme token deployed in the EVM (Ethereum Virtual Machine). ayeAyeCoin was deployed on August 20, 2015, three weeks after Ethereum mainnet launch. ayeAyeCoin only existed in this original Ethereum chain, until the infamous The DAO Hack happened and Ethereum Foundation decided to fork the chain in the block #1920000, creating a โ€œnew-community created blockchainโ€ which rolled back the malicious smart contract code which led to the attack. Ethereum Foundation named as Ethereum this โ€œnew-community created blockchainโ€ and renamed as Ethereum Classic the original Ethereum chain where ayeAyeCoin was deployed. As Ethereum Classic chain was forked, all the existing contracts, wallets, tokens, collectibles and balances were duplicated in this new chain (everything was duplicated, with the exception of part of the smart contract code which the hacker used n to exploit The DAO, breaking the immutability principle of the blockchain) resulting as well in the creation of an ayeAyeCoin โ€œtwinโ€ ($WAAC). Ethereum Foundation chain was also forked few years later, in September 2022, leading to a new chain called Ethereum Proof of Work resulting in the creation of a new ayeAyeCoin โ€œtwinโ€. New forks of the original Ethereum Classic chain will lead to the creation of new ayeAyeCoin โ€œtwinsโ€. About the token launch, in a similar way to the well-known @cryptopunksnfts, ayeAyeCoin was almost โ€œfree to claimโ€ as it had a faucet which contained the 6,000,000 coins: By using the โ€œcoinBegโ€ function, anyone willing to pay a small fee could get one ayeAyeCoin from the contract dispenser. Once the function was executed, the coin was sent to the petitioner and the โ€œayeAyeCoin Love! One coin for you!โ€ message was displayed, until the faucet ran dry when the message โ€œSorry, the faucet has entirely run dryโ€ was displayed instead. As the faucet was discovered in Ethereum by one NFT archeologist in May 2024, all the tokens were claimed in June, so the total supply is circulating.
